How to Stop Your Dog from Chewing or Licking Their Paws

WebClipping the hair away from the hot spot and the surrounding area can be very helpful, especially if your dog has a thick coat. The hot spot will heal more quickly if the hair is removed so that the lesion can dry properly. Grooming may be painful so your dog may need to be sedated. The lesion should be disinfected with a chlorhexidine solution ... WebMix 1 part raw, unfiltered apple cider vinegar and 2 parts water in a large bowl. Soak your doggy’s paws in the solution for up to 5 minutes. Do not rinse off, but make sure that you dry the paws thoroughly afterwards. …

When your dog grabs the toy, start … how to shave with a traditional razorWebApr 11, 2024 · Wrapping your pet’s paws to stop biting and chewing is usually not a good idea. Many pets will simply rip off the bandaging, and some will even eat it, which can lead to intestinal obstruction. If the bandage is applied too tightly, it can cut off circulation to the paw and cause tissue death. notrad ford
